MDF board, or Medium Density Fiberboard, is a type of engineered wood product made from wood fibers and resin. It’s a versatile material that has gained popularity over the years for its affordability, workability, and durability. Furniture Making

One of the most common uses for MDF board is in furniture making. It’s perfect for creating sturdy and stylish pieces that won’t break the bank. Whether you’re building a bed frame, a bookshelf, or a coffee table, MDF board is up to the task. Plus, its smooth surface makes it easy to paint or stain, allowing you to create a unique look that fits your personal style.

Cabinetry and Millwork

MDF board is also a popular choice for cabinetry and millwork. It’s strong enough to hold up under daily use, and its smooth surface makes it easy to apply finishes and detailing. This makes it a go-to material for kitchen cabinets, bathroom vanities, and built-in storage solutions.

Wall Paneling and Wainscoting

For those looking to add a touch of elegance to their home, MDF board can be used for wall paneling and wainscoting. Its durability and resistance to warping make it an ideal choice for this application. Plus, its ease of installation means you can create a stunning feature wall without breaking a sweat.

Sign Making and Displays

MDF board is also a popular choice for sign making and displays. Its lightweight nature and ease of cutting make it perfect for creating eye-catching signs and displays for businesses, events, and more. Plus, its smooth surface makes it easy to apply graphics and paint, allowing for a high-quality finish.

Art and Craft Projects

For those with a creative streak, MDF board is a fantastic material for art and craft projects. Its smooth surface and ease of cutting make it perfect for creating sculptures, picture frames, and other decorative items. Plus, its affordability means you can let your imagination run wild without worrying about the cost.
